Chlordiazepoxide Hydrochloride for Injection
» Chlordiazepoxide Hydrochloride for Injection is Chlordiazepoxide Hydrochloride suitable for parenteral use.
Packaging and storage— Preserve in Containers for Sterile Solids as described under Injections 1, protected from light.
Completeness of solution 641 It dissolves in the solvent and in the concentration recommended in the labeling to yield a clear solution.
Constituted solution— At the time of use, it meets the requirements for Constituted Solutions under Labeling under Injections 1.
Bacterial endotoxins 85 It contains not more than 3.57 USP Endotoxin Units per mg of chlordiazepoxide hydrochloride.
pH 791: between 2.5 and 3.5, in a solution (1 in 100).
Other requirements— It responds to the Identification tests and meets the requirements of the tests for Loss on drying and Heavy metals under Chlordiazepoxide Hydrochloride, and the test for Related compounds under Chlordiazepoxide. It meets also the requirements for Sterility Tests 71, Uniformity of Dosage Units 905, and Labeling under Injections 1.
Assay— Proceed with Chlordiazepoxide Hydrochloride for Injection as directed in the Assay under Chlordiazepoxide, except to use USP Chlordiazepoxide Hydrochloride RS to prepare the Standard preparation.
